Choosing the Right Miter Saw for Aluminium

Selecting a correct miter saw for processing aluminum extrusions requires specific assessment . Unlike lumber, aluminum remains relatively soft and can easily buckle if your cutting tool isn't designed accurately . cnc machine Look for a high-quality cutting edge , often with 60 or more teeth per unit – these reduces chipping and creates a accurate separation. Furthermore, a cold-cutting cutter is essential to reduce heat build-up , which could compromise the metal and your cutter itself.

Cutting Aluminium with Precision: Miter Saw Techniques

Achieving precise cuts in the metal with a compound miter saw requires specific techniques. Initially, ensure your blade is rated for soft metals; using a wood blade will soon ruin it and create a uneven edge. Then , diminish the feed rate – a slower speed prevents the sticking of the material. Ultimately, use a coolant like mineral oil to additionally reduce friction and create a polished finish .

Aluminium Power Up-Cutting and Miter Saws Comparison

When working with aluminum extrusions for projects , the selection between an upcut and a miter saws becomes important. Upcut saws typically provide a smoother cut , minimizing tearout in the material by clearing chips upwards the surface . However, they may be not as accurate for complex angles cuts . Conversely , a miter saw, especially a compound miter saw, shines at making precise miter cuts and repeated outcomes, though it could generate slightly more fuzz requiring further cleanup. Ultimately, the best tool depends on the particular task and the desired level of finish .
